Livingstone Mqotsi, also known as Livy, was a South African social anthropologist and activist. Born in a low-income family, his academic journey led him to Fort Hare University, where he studied social anthropology and became one of Monica Wilson's distinguished students. He engaged in activism and resistance against apartheid and was known for mobilising communities.
